What does gawming mean?
Gawming means (chiefly UK, dialectal, Rutland, Leicestershire, but also US) Alternative form of gorming..

(chiefly UK, dialectal, Rutland, Leicestershire, but also US) Alternative form of gorming..
Yet Nancy's gawming son Set free more sad and hopeless men Than any king has done;
A sniff of strong ammonia could not have revived Martha's drooping spirits more effectually. “Miss him!” she repeated, “don't worry about my missin' that gawming creature. I shall be able to keep things decently clean after he's out o' the way.”
